The Future Of Cigarette Smoking In Hawaii Is NIL

By 2024, In Hawaii, you may be too young to smoke! That's correct. According to a proposed piece of legislation, the legal smoking age, by the year, 2024 will be 100 years of age. Not 100 yet, then no ciagarettes for you. Read about this here. Ryan Prior, CNN, February 4, 2019: Hawaii Is Considering A Bill That Bans Cigarette Sales To Anyone Under 100.
